The Phenomenon: From Solar Panels to a National Energy Movement
Gone are the days of navigating a fragmented maze of installers, permits, and subsidy applications alone. A national portal for rooftop solar acts as a centralized, government-backed platform. It typically allows homeowners and businesses to assess their roof's solar potential, connect with certified installers, understand financial incentives, and often manage the bureaucratic paperwork digitally. The goal is clear: to accelerate solar adoption by making the process transparent, trustworthy, and efficient. It's a transformative shift from a piecemeal, DIY approach to a coordinated, national strategy for decentralized energy production.
The Data: Why Rooftop Solar Portals Are Gaining Traction
The drive behind these national portals is backed by compelling numbers. According to the International Energy Agency (IEA), solar PV is on track to become the largest source of installed power capacity globally by 2027. In the European Union, the REPowerEU plan explicitly aims to harness the potential of rooftop solar, setting ambitious targets to double solar capacity by 2025. In the United States, the Inflation Reduction Act has supercharged investment, with forecasts predicting a tripling of installed solar capacity by 2033. National portals are the logistical engines designed to turn these policy targets into physical panels on millions of rooftops.
| Region | Initiative/Portal Example | Core Function |
|---|---|---|
| Germany | Marktstammdatenregister (MaStR) | Central registry for all energy-generating units, mandatory registration for grid connection and feed-in tariffs. |
| United States | EnergySaver.gov & State-level tools | Federal and state resources for calculators, tax credit info, and finding installers. |
| Netherlands | "Zonnepanelen op je dak" initiatives | Municipal and national websites offering quick solar potential scans and collective purchasing schemes. |

The Critical Insight: Generation is Only Half the Story
This is the pivotal insight many discover after using a national rooftop solar portal. These portals excel at getting the panels on your roof and connected to the grid. But they often stop at the meter. The true economic and environmental prize isn't just generating solar energy; it's consuming it on-site, on-demand. Without storage, a significant portion of your self-generated, cheap, green power flows back to the grid, leaving you vulnerable to peak grid prices and outages.
- The Self-Consumption Challenge: Without storage, typical self-consumption rates for solar-only systems often range from 30-50%, meaning half your solar investment is exported.
- The Grid Dependency Paradox: You remain 100% reliant on the grid when the sun isn't shining, missing the chance for true backup power and price independence.
